The Kenya Revenue Authority (KRA) is offering a three-month Industrial Attachment program within the Security & Safety department. This program is designed for continuing undergraduate and diploma students to gain practical experience and exposure in a professional environment, helping them bridge the gap between academic learning and the workplace.
Responsibilities and Duties
Assist in monitoring security protocols and safety standards within the organization.
Support the security team in routine surveillance and incident reporting.
Help maintain records related to safety inspections and security clearances.
Participate in emergency response drills and safety awareness initiatives.
Observe and learn the operational procedures of a large-scale government security wing.
Requirements, Skills, and Experiences
Be a Kenyan Citizen aged below 35 years.
Must be a continuing 1st degree student (Undergraduate) in their 3rd, 4th, or final year of study, or a Diploma student in their final year from a recognised University/College.
Must possess a valid introduction letter from the University/College.
Must be available full-time for the three-month duration of the program.
If selected, candidates must submit proof of valid Personal Accident Insurance Cover, KRA PIN certificate, NHIF/SHIF, NSSF, ID card, and Bank Account details.
Additional Details
Duration: The program is for 3 months and is not subject to extension.
Stipend: A monthly stipend of KShs. 7,000 will be paid (subject to statutory deductions).
Selection: Only selected candidates will be contacted. KRA does not charge any fee for this process.
